Trempealeau County (WQOW) - A highway in Trempealeau
County has reopened
after a fatal crash Wednesday.
According to authorities, a semi traveling on State
Highway 54 near the Township
Of Gale, lost control on
a curve, flipped onto it's side and struck a motorcycle. The driver of the
motorcycle was pronounced dead at the scene. The driver of the semi had minor
injuries.
While authorities were investigating the highway was closed for seven
hours before re-opening overnight. The accident is still under investigation.
The name of the motorcyclist has not yet been released.
